Willow Valley is a locality in Mohave County, Arizona, United States. It is a small community with a population of 981. The population density is 63.9 people per km². Willow Valley is located at 34.9119°N, 114.6066°W. It observes the Mountain Standard Time — no DST (America/Phoenix) timezone. ZIP code: 86440.

It lies 16.4 miles south of Bullhead City, AZ (from Bullhead City, AZ: bearing 188°T), and is situated 7.7 miles south of Fort Mohave.
